Kansas City Chiefs cornerback Darrelle Revis will make his official debut into the fashion industry with the release of the GG X DR capsule collection.

As part of a 10 piece limited collection, Revis showcased his new designs during fashion week in New York City. Presented by Grungy Gentleman designer Jace Lipstein, the brand featured short and long sleeve tees, crewneck sweatshirts, shorts with a legging insert, joggers, and a windbreaker in hues of heather grey and black. The line sports 3M reflective detailing accents select pieces along with Darrelle’s bold trademarked logo, and the six stripes that represents Grungy Gentleman signature look. For Revis, fashion was a natural progression from his elaborate sports career.

“In the creative process we managed to share ideas which eventually became the foundation of this collaboration. One idea was to include 3M reflective material to make the collection establish a casual personality in addition to being stylish. Sportswear has become very mainstream in today’s fashion and the Darrelle Revis brand is excited to be teaming up with Grungy Gentleman for its first capsule collection.” – Darrelle Revis

Debuting the brand with two consecutive packed shows, viewers were treated to a brand that welcomes diversity. Grungy Gentleman’s casual looks are ones that can easily transcend from day wear to a night on the town with signature blazers that could prop up any style. To help him kick off his new fashion endeavor Revis brought some of NFL buddies to walk to in the show.  Dallas Cowboys cornerback Nolan Carroll, Seattle Seahawks strong safety Kam Chancellor, and NY Giants running back Wayne Gallman all hit the runway rocking the brand.

Besides walking in the show Revis will also be featured in the upcoming lookbook for the brand.
